Chin Up (Assisted)

A movement that trains your lats, done with a machine. Your biceps and forearms help out.

How to do it

  1. Adjust the leverage machine to your desired resistance level.
  2. Stand on the foot platform and grip the handles with an overhand grip, slightly wider than shoulder-width apart.
  3. Hang with your arms fully extended, keeping your body straight.
  4. Engage your back muscles and pull your body up towards the handles, leading with your chest.
  5. Continue pulling until your chin is above the handles.
  6. Pause for a moment at the top, then slowly lower your body back down to the starting position.
  7. Repeat for the desired number of repetitions.
